Slender rectangle would be ok, but not square in this case. It would create too tight of a cluster. Round will provide some needed soft lines.

You have a great space! I think in order to relieve some of the heavy, boxy furniture in your room, you should add a round and airy coffee table. The best choice for this arrangement would be something with thinner legs and a glass or marble top. This will create a balance in the room instead of competing with the heavy furniture.
Also, I think that a woven neutral colored rug would look beautiful. This would also contribute to the balance of the room while making it even cozier than it already looks.
